Understanding Financial Incentives in Homework Systems
Short answer: Paying students for homework performance means attaching monetary or reward-based compensation to task completion or quality of assignments.
In practice, this approach transforms homework from a purely academic responsibility into a transactional activity. Schools experimenting with incentive-based systems often aim to improve compliance rates among students who struggle with consistency.
For example, in some pilot programs in urban districts across the United States, small payments or reward points were used to encourage homework submission in mathematics and reading tasks.
Example: A middle school introduced a system where students received points convertible into bookstore vouchers for consistent homework completion over a month.

Arguments Supporting Payment for Homework Performance
Short answer: Financial incentives can improve participation rates, especially among disengaged learners or in under-resourced environments.
Research in behavioral psychology shows that external rewards can effectively trigger action in repetitive tasks. Homework, especially in early grades, often falls into this category.

Case observation: In a pilot program referenced in educational policy reviews within OECD member countries, short-term reward systems improved attendance in after-school homework clubs by up to 25%.
Arguments Against Paying Students for Homework Performance
Short answer: Financial incentives risk undermining intrinsic motivation and may distort the learning process.
When students begin associating learning with money, the focus can shift from curiosity and mastery to reward acquisition.

Teachers often report that once incentives stop, participation drops sharply, suggesting dependency rather than habit formation.
Psychological Mechanisms Behind Student Motivation
Short answer: Motivation shifts between intrinsic (internal satisfaction) and extrinsic (external rewards), and balance determines long-term learning outcomes.
Educational psychology distinguishes between autonomy-driven learning and reward-driven compliance. When external rewards dominate, internal curiosity may weaken.
Example: A student initially interested in science begins focusing only on completing homework for rewards, not exploration of experiments.
- Intrinsic: curiosity, mastery, personal interest
- Extrinsic: grades, money, rewards
- Hybrid: structured rewards with autonomy support

Real-World Classroom Observations
Short answer: Real classroom outcomes show mixed results depending on implementation quality and cultural expectations.
In Scandinavian educational contexts, including schools in Finland, emphasis is placed on intrinsic motivation and minimal external reward systems.
By contrast, some experimental programs in urban schools across North America show short-term performance improvements but inconsistent long-term retention.

Equity and Fairness Considerations
Short answer: Payment systems can unintentionally widen educational inequalities.
Students from higher socioeconomic backgrounds may not be equally motivated by small financial incentives, while others may depend heavily on them, creating imbalance.
Key Equity Risks
- Unequal baseline motivation levels
- Different access to support at home
- Varying perception of monetary value
Example: Two students in the same class respond differently to a reward system; one sees it as motivation, another sees it as unnecessary pressure.
Teacher Workload and Implementation Reality
Short answer: Reward systems increase administrative complexity and require consistent monitoring to remain effective.
Teachers must track performance, distribute rewards, and maintain fairness, which can increase workload significantly.
- Define clear criteria for rewards
- Ensure transparency in evaluation
- Prevent reward inflation
- Balance rewards with feedback

How incentive systems actually function in learning environments:
Reward-based homework systems operate by shifting behavioral triggers from internal interest to external reinforcement. When a reward is introduced, the brain prioritizes task completion linked to immediate gain rather than long-term understanding.
What actually matters most:
- Whether the task is repetitive or conceptually deep
- Age and cognitive development stage
- Consistency of reward application
- Presence of autonomy and choice in learning
Common mistakes in implementation:
- Over-rewarding simple tasks
- Removing feedback in favor of payment
- Ignoring emotional engagement
- Applying uniform systems across diverse learners
Decision factors teachers consider:
- Student baseline motivation
- Class size and manageability
- Curriculum demands
- Long-term learning goals
The strongest outcomes emerge when rewards are used sparingly and combined with meaningful feedback and autonomy support rather than replacing learning incentives entirely.

Frequently Asked Questions
1. Does paying students improve homework completion?
Yes, but mostly in the short term. Long-term effects depend on whether intrinsic motivation is preserved.
2. What age groups respond best to rewards?
Younger students generally respond more strongly to external incentives than older adolescents.
3. Can rewards replace grades?
No. Rewards influence behavior, while grades measure academic performance and understanding.
4. What are the biggest risks of payment systems?
Reduced curiosity, dependency on rewards, and inequity among students.
5. Are non-monetary rewards better?
In many cases, yes. Privileges and feedback tend to have fewer negative side effects.
6. How do teachers manage fairness?
By setting transparent criteria and ensuring consistent application of rules.
7. Do reward systems work in all subjects?
They are more effective in structured, repetitive subjects like math practice than in creative tasks.
8. What happens when rewards stop?
Motivation often drops unless habits have been strongly established.
9. Can students become dependent on rewards?
Yes, especially when rewards replace rather than support learning motivation.
10. Are there ethical concerns?
Yes, especially regarding fairness and the commercialization of education.
11. How do parents view payment systems?
Opinions vary widely depending on cultural and socioeconomic context.
12. What is a balanced approach?
Combining feedback, autonomy, and limited rewards tends to work best.
13. Do rewards improve learning quality?
Not necessarily; they often improve completion more than comprehension.
14. Can schools scale such systems?
Scalability is challenging due to administrative workload.
